The front of this stunning historic home is nestled between two beautiful large live oak trees. The home was built in 1917 and sits on a huge .33 acre corner lot in the heart of Navasota. The location could not be more ideal close proximity to shops, antique stores, and restaurants in downtown Navasota. This home boasts 4 nice sized bedrooms plus an office/study, updated kitchen, and fully remodeled 1.5 baths. There is a downstairs bathroom with a sink and shower however, it is currently not functional. You can finish it out as you wish. There is also a detached 2 spot carport and a garden shop/1 car garage. The home was leveled in '22 by the current homeowner. This home is a must see in the very much up and coming town of Navasota.
